Square Yard Calculator

The Square Yard Calculator is a specialized digital tool designed to determine the total surface area of a space in square yards. This tool is primarily utilized in industries such as landscaping, construction, and interior design, where materials like carpet, artificial turf, and mulch are frequently sold by the square yard. In practical usage, this tool provides a streamlined method for converting linear measurements into area-based units, reducing the manual calculation errors often associated with multi-unit conversions.

Understanding Square Yards

A square yard is a unit of area measurement in the imperial and US customary systems. It represents the area of a square with sides that are exactly one yard (3 feet or 36 inches) in length. Understanding this unit is essential when dealing with bulk material orders or professional flooring installations, as it standardizes the amount of coverage needed across varying dimensions.

How the Calculation Works

The calculation process involves identifying the length and width of a rectangular or square area. The tool operates by first ensuring all inputs are in a consistent unit and then applying the area formula. When I tested this with real inputs, I observed that the most efficient method is to convert all dimensions to yards before multiplying, though many users prefer calculating the total square footage first and then dividing by the conversion factor.

Main Formula

The mathematical foundation of the calculator relies on the relationship between linear feet and square yardage.

\text{Area (sq yd)} = \text{Length (yd)} \times \text{Width (yd)} \\ \text{or} \\ \text{Area (sq yd)} = \frac{\text{Length (ft)} \times \text{Width (ft)}}{9} \\ \text{or} \\ \text{Area (sq yd)} = \frac{\text{Length (in)} \times \text{Width (in)}}{1,296}

Standard Values and Conversions

In construction and renovation, specific conversion constants are used to move between different units of area. Based on repeated tests, the following constants are the most relevant for validating results:

  • 1 Square Yard = 9 Square Feet
  • 1 Square Yard = 1,296 Square Inches
  • 1 Square Yard = 0.836 Square Meters

Interpretation Table for Common Areas

The following table provides a reference for typical area sizes encountered during tool usage.

Project Type Dimensions (Feet) Square Feet Square Yards
Small Closet 3 x 3 9 1
Standard Bedroom 12 x 12 144 16
Large Living Room 20 x 15 300 33.33
Two-Car Garage 20 x 20 400 44.44
Average Lawn 50 x 50 2,500 277.77

Worked Calculation Examples

Example 1: Calculating Flooring for a Room Suppose a room measures 18 feet in length and 15 feet in width.

  1. Multiply length by width: 18 \times 15 = 270 \text{ square feet}.
  2. Divide by 9: 270 / 9 = 30 \text{ square yards}.

Example 2: Small Scale Patching Suppose a small garden patch measures 72 inches by 72 inches.

  1. Multiply length by width: 72 \times 72 = 5,184 \text{ square inches}.
  2. Divide by 1,296: 5,184 / 1,296 = 4 \text{ square yards}.

Related Concepts and Assumptions

The Square Yard Calculator assumes the area is a perfect rectangle or square. For irregular shapes, the area is typically broken down into smaller rectangular sections and then summed. Additionally, users should assume a "waste factor"—usually 5% to 10%—when ordering materials to account for cuts and overlaps. This is where most users make mistakes; they calculate the exact area but fail to account for the physical realities of installation.

Common Mistakes and Limitations

What I noticed while validating results across various scenarios is that errors most frequently stem from unit mismatches.

  • Mixing Units: Entering one dimension in feet and another in inches without conversion leads to incorrect outputs.
  • The Factor of Nine: A frequent error is dividing square footage by 3 instead of 9. Because 1 yard equals 3 feet, many assume 1 square yard equals 3 square feet, whereas the true value is 3 \times 3 = 9.
  • Depth Considerations: This free Square Yard Calculator measures surface area (2D). It does not calculate volume (Cubic Yards). For materials like mulch or concrete that require depth, a volume calculator should be used instead.
